Definition of Sham

Sham
Sham Sham, a. False; counterfeit; pretended; feigned; unreal; as, a sham fight. They scorned the sham independence proffered to them by the Athenians. --Jowett (Thucyd)
Sham
Sham Sham, v. i. To make false pretenses; to deceive; to feign; to impose. Wondering . . . whether those who lectured him were such fools as they professed to be, or were only shamming. --Macaulay.
Sham
Sham Sham, n. [Originally the same word as shame, hence, a disgrace, a trick. See Shame, n.] 1. That which deceives expectation; any trick, fraud, or device that deludes and disappoint; a make-believe; delusion; imposture, humbug. ``A mere sham.' --Bp. Stillingfleet. Believe who will the solemn sham, not I. --Addison. 2. A false front, or removable ornamental covering. Pillow sham, a covering to be laid on a pillow.
